For the 2026 school year, there is 1 community college serving 5,294 students in the neighborhood of South Mountain Village, Phoenix, AZ.
Minority enrollment is 81% of the student body (majority Hispanic).
The student:teacher ratio of 18:1 is less than the state average of 22:1.
